We did genesight testing with our son and learned that he processes only about 30% of the folate he ingests. When we read more, we learned that methyfolate is a form of folate that is bioavailable to him, and that folic acid is not. Because of his genetic difference in processing folate, supplementing with methylfolate and methylcobalamin (they are synergistic and need to be taken together) has made a significant difference. We now, as a family, take broad spectrum micronutrients, fish oil, and probiotic, after all, our genes are his genes :)
